Output ec7a4603c5976a8874dfd91f90fca820e15ea03e35540bad76fffee33fb5c2e7:0

value
436134
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8dd66f9a208cad5901bd43affc4b3783aa065e6a OP_EQUAL
address
3Ecz5ryqn7Yqo9qRz1PsgSTEFQB7CogFFa
transaction
ec7a4603c5976a8874dfd91f90fca820e15ea03e35540bad76fffee33fb5c2e7
confirmations
215481
spent
true